About the role

Role Overview

You will serve as Product Owner within a Scrum team, owning backlog prioritization and driving release planning and delivery. The position focuses on healthcare/product needs, including alignment with regulatory and industry changes.

Responsibilities

  • Own the product backlog: prioritize items, define user stories, sprint objectives, and acceptance criteria.
  • Lead release planning: define release scope and timelines, coordinate across technology and business teams.
  • Ensure release delivery readiness: manage communication and alignment with development schedules and quality standards.
  • Partner with Engineering to deliver user-friendly, efficient product interfaces.
  • Lead and participate in Agile ceremonies, including:
    • Stand-ups
    • Sprint planning
    • Sprint reviews
    • PI planning
    • Retrospectives
  • Maintain clear, professional communication across all levels of the organization.
  • Stay current on industry trends, regulatory changes, and innovations in population health and value-based contracting.
  • Author release notes and support demos and field training as needed to keep clients informed.

Qualifications

  • 3–5+ years of experience as a Product Owner (preferably health tech or another regulated industry).
  • Proven experience working in Agile/Scrum environments.
  • Strong understanding of release planning, release management, and product delivery.
  • Experience collaborating with UI/UX teams to deliver intuitive user experiences.
  • Knowledge of care coordination, risk adjustment, and value-based reimbursement models.
  • Proficient with Jira and Confluence; familiarity with design tools such as Figma and Miro.
  • Strong analytical, organizational, and communication skills.
  • Bachelor’s degree preferred.
